Key Features to Look for in Stamping Machines in 2026
When considering stamping machines in 2026, several critical features should be prioritized. Buyers need to focus on durability. Machines that withstand heavy use are preferable for long-term investment. Look for robust materials and solid construction. This can reduce maintenance needs and enhance overall productivity.
Energy efficiency is another crucial aspect. Machines should consume less power while delivering high performance. This not only cuts down operational costs but also aligns with global sustainability goals. Additionally, consider machines with advanced technology. Automation features can improve precision and reduce manual labor, ultimately increasing output.

Emerging Technologies in Stamping Machinery for 2026
In 2026, stamping machinery is poised for a significant transformation. Emerging technologies will redefine efficiency and precision. Industry reports indicate that automation and artificial intelligence (AI) will streamline stamping processes. These advancements could reduce production times by up to 30%. Such efficiency is critical for meeting rising global demands.
One notable trend is the integration of IoT (Internet of Things) in stamping machines. IoT-enabled devices will monitor performance in real-time. This capability allows for predictive maintenance, potentially decreasing downtime by 40%. However, reliance on technology raises concerns about cybersecurity. Manufacturers must address vulnerabilities in connected systems.
The use of advanced materials is another emerging technology. Lightweight alloys and composites offer strength without extra weight. This change could enhance product design and reduce energy consumption. Yet, adapting to these materials presents challenges. Manufacturers must invest in training and equipment updates. The path to advanced stamping technology involves both opportunity and risk.

Considerations for Importing Stamping Machines to Global Markets
When considering the import of stamping machines to global markets, several key factors emerge. Understanding local regulations is crucial. Compliance can impact your supply chain and operational efficiency. For example, syntax variations in compliance documentation could lead to delays. Market analysis shows that approximately 30% of companies face unexpected hurdles in customs clearance due to inadequate paperwork.
Additionally, addressing environmental standards is essential. Many regions are tightening regulations on emissions and waste management. Among industrial machinery, stamping machines can often generate significant waste. According to recent industry reports, over 40% of stampers are now designed to minimize waste. Global buyers should prioritize machines that meet these emerging sustainability criteria.
